If your child is struggling with math, it may not be because they are not trying hard enough. When math doesn’t make sense, students may resort to memorization rather than truly understanding what they are doing.
At the root, many struggle to form clear mental images of mathematical concepts, making it harder to see relationships, follow processes, and solve problems with confidence.
Join our free webinar to learn how On Cloud Nine® Math instruction develops the ability to visualize and verbalize math, helping students think, reason, and apply their learning in meaningful ways.
